Title
Dept/ Agency: Administration/Division of Central Purchasing
Action: ( x ) Ratifying ( X ) Authorizing ( ) Amending
Type of Service: Extension of Emergency Contract #E2015-05 - 2015-05A
Purpose: Temporary Professional Personnel Services
Entity Name(s)/Address(s): (1.) Axion Healthcare Solution, LLC, 510 Thornall Street, 110 Edison, NJ 08837
(2.) Delta T. Group North Jersey, Inc., One Woodbridge Center, Suite 512, Woodbridge, New Jersey 07095

Contract Amount: $ 150,000.00 per month for three (3) months
Funding Source: City of Newark Budget/ Department of Health and Community Wellness
Contract Period: Extension from June 4, 2015 through September 3, 2015, or until such time as a contract is entered into
Contract Basis: ( ) Bid ( ) State Vendor ( x ) Prof. Ser. ( ) EUS
( ) Fair & Open ( ) No Reportable Contributions ( ) RFP ( ) RFQ
( ) Private Sale ( ) Grant ( ) Sub-recipient ( ) n/a
Additional Information:

WHEREAS, on March 4, 2015 through June 3, 2015 an emergency contract was entered into for temporary professional services to allow for the continued operation of the medical centers; and

WHEREAS, it is imperative that the City continue to maintain the level of staffing necessary for a licensed Ambulatory Care Facility; and

WHEREAS, pursuant to N.J.S.A. 40A:11-6 the extension of the emergency contract is needed for the public health, safety and welfare of the community; and

WHEREAS, pursuant to N.J.A.C.5:34-6.1, the City is in need of an extension of the existing emergency contracts #E2015-05 and E2015-5A, in order to maintain the level of primary medical services and public health services ...
